Continous Flow Stirred Tank Digestors - These digestered are continuously fed as well as stirred to achieve a very high mixing; the spent substrate is also continuously removed. They are suited to treat medium to high strength (2-10% solids) wastes.

Mixing is achieved either mechanically or by recirculation of the biogas. Gas may be collected in a separate tank or the digester itself may have a floating roof.
